The Benefits Of Using A Retail EPOS System

In today’s increasingly digital world, businesses are constantly looking for ways to streamline their operations and improve efficiency One way that retailers are achieving this is through the use of Retail EPOS systems

EPOS, which stands for Electronic Point of Sale, is the modern replacement for traditional cash registers These systems combine hardware and software to help businesses process transactions, manage inventory, and even analyze sales data In the retail industry, where competition is fierce and margins can be slim, having an efficient EPOS system can make all the difference.

One of the biggest benefits of using a retail EPOS system is its ability to streamline the checkout process With a traditional cash register, cashiers have to manually enter product prices and calculate totals, which can lead to errors and long wait times for customers With an EPOS system, all of this information is stored digitally, making checkout fast and accurate This can lead to happier customers and increased sales.

Another advantage of using a retail EPOS system is its ability to manage inventory in real time When a product is scanned at the checkout, the system automatically updates the inventory levels, giving retailers a clear picture of what products are selling well and which ones are not This can help businesses make smarter purchasing decisions, avoid stock shortages, and reduce the risk of overstocking.

In addition to streamlining operations and managing inventory, a retail EPOS system can also provide valuable insights into sales data By analyzing this data, retailers can identify trends, understand customer purchasing behavior, and make informed decisions about pricing and promotions This can help businesses increase profitability and stay ahead of the competition.
